What an Registered Agent? An registered agent is an specific individual or business entity that serves as authorized to receive legal documents and government notifications on behalf of a company. Such role serves as vital for ensuring that the business stays compliant with state regulations, as it acts as the primary contact for service of process and other important communications. Registered agents are a critical role for corporations and limited liability companies (LLCs) to maintain their legal status. Registered agent services can be provided by individuals or professional companies specializing in handling statutory representation and compliance management for businesses. These registered agent providers offer various solutions, including support with legal document handling, maintaining a registered office, and providing compliance reminders. By choosing a reliable registered agent, businesses can make sure that they are timely informed of any legal issues or required filings. Roles and Responsibilities Registered representatives serve as a vital link between a business entity and the government in which it functions. Their primary function is to accept court documents and government notices on behalf of the company. This encompasses summons and complaints, tax filings, and compliance notifications. By acting as the designated recipient for important documents, registered agents help ensure that businesses remain informed and in line with legal standards. In addition to handling service of process notifications, registered agents are responsible for maintaining a registered office. This office serves as the registered address, where all important documents are forwarded. It is vital for registered agents to confirm that their registered address is updated with the authorities and available during standard operating hours. This ensures timely arrival of any important messages and reduces the risk of overlooking deadlines. Further, many registered agents deliver extra solutions that go beyond basic document management. These may include annual compliance filings, forwarding business correspondence, and assistance in corporate governance affairs. By providing these offerings, registered agents contribute significantly to the overall compliance management and security of the business entity, allowing entrepreneurs to focus on their core operations while remaining in good standing with state requirements. Advantages of Hiring a Official Representative Employing a designated representative provides crucial aid for organizations, ensuring conformity with local requirements. A official agent is tasked with receiving critical legal papers and notifications, including summons and scheduled compliance alerts. This enables company owners to focus on day-to-day activities while maintaining that they adhere to statutory obligations with statutory requirements. By having a reliable registered agent, companies can prevent possible sanctions and judicial complications that may occur from overlooked filings or timelines. A significant advantage is enhanced confidentiality and safety. Organizations that decide to appoint a designated representative can shield their private information off public records. This is notably beneficial for home-based companies as it prevents unwanted inquiries and protects the owner's confidentiality. A reliable official agent can also offer secure management of sensitive papers, guaranteeing that crucial law-related files are processed professionally and with discretion. Compliance and Lawful Conditions Designated representatives play a crucial role in guaranteeing that businesses adhere with regulatory requirements and regulations. Every state has distinct registered agent requirements that must be fulfilled for a company to stay good standing. This includes possessing a tangible location within the state where the registered agent functions. Digital registered agent services offer organizations a simple way to fulfill this requirement while guaranteeing legal compliance. Thus, grasping state registered agent laws is crucial for company leaders seeking to avoid sanctions and preserve operational legitimacy. In addition to meeting state requirements, registered agents serve as the contact point for legal notices and process serving. This means they are tasked for handling important messages, such as court actions and official state correspondence. A dependable registered agent is essential for guaranteeing that these documents are handled properly and forwarded promptly to the company owner. Many organizations opt for specialized registered agent services that specialize in legal document handling to safeguard against overlooked messages, which could lead to serious legal and financial ramifications.
